I'm having the exact same issue but my router is not in AP mode, nor is it in bridge mode. Just started a few days ago. Can't access router web console via hardwire or wireless, and Orbi app can't find it. All devices working fine. DHCP still assigning addresses without issue. What is the Mfr and model# of the Internet Service Providers modem/ONT the NG router is connected too?Try a 30/30/30 reset:
-
With the router plugged in and powered on, depress the reset button for 30 seconds. This button is usually a tiny dot recessed into the back of the router. You may need a jeweler's screwdriver or a bent paperclip to access it.
-
While still holding down the button, unplug the router from its power source for another 30 seconds.
-
With the reset button still held down, turn the power back on and hold for another 30 seconds.
